Reporting the loss or theft of an identity card abroad

Main information

When abroad you have an obligation to report immediately the loss, theft, the risk of misuse of data in the identification certificate or the destruction of an identity card or its finding to the nearest embassy.

What you need if you are using this service

You must go to the nearest embassy to report the loss or theft of your identity card. You will give your personal data, i.e. name, surname, date of birth, permanent residence, etc.

Where and how to solve this service

ou can apply to any embassy abroad.

The embassy to which the loss, theft, danger of misuse of data in the identification certificate or destruction of the identity card or its finding has been reported, shall immediately forward this information to the municipal authority of the municipality with extended powers that issued the identity card.

The embassy will issue you with a confirmation of the loss, theft or destruction of the identity card or the risk of misuse of the data in the identification certificate.

An identity card ceases to be valid when its loss, theft or destruction or the risk of misuse of data in the identification certificate are reported.

Lost and stolen documents are listed in the identity card registration information system. The number of the identity card and the date of loss or theft are also shown on the website of the Ministry of the Interior in its database of invalid documents. This database is mainly used by banks and other financial institutions, making the misuse of lost or stolen documents more difficult.

Lost and stolen documents are also kept in the Schengen Information System and in the Interpol database and this makes it more difficult for the document to be misused abroad.

Sanctions

You commit an administrative offence by failing to protect an identity card against loss, theft, damage, destruction or misuse.

A fine of up to CZK 10 000 may be imposed for this offence.
